Our hostel has a private bathroom in each of the 10 rooms, central heating, enclosed parking, guarded day and night by our staff, room service, Continental breakfast buffet, Internet access without any time restriction or registration, a very quiet area just steps from the Alemania Ave, the main center of entretencion and city business.

This is a well situated comfortable and modest hotel in Temuco. The room is nice but the bathrooms are extra small, both in terms of showering space and in terms of places to put things. Heating is good. Breakfast is OK but always the same, so if you're going to stay more than a couple of days you will tire of it. The people that are in charge are extremely helpful and nice.

This small and simple hotel is a great option to stay in Temuco. Located not too far from the downtown area, the hotel is in the end of a no traffic street (it has no exit). The area is safe and one can use the colectivos to get into town. The rooms are clean and comfortable (the acoustics could be improved). The staff is top notch: always willing to help. Breakfast is very simple, offering bread and some cold cuts. I would stay here again.

This is a small, clean, and well-run inn with a friendly and helpful staff. The rooms are small and basic but the beds are comfortable. It is well-located, on a cul-de-sac near the centre of Temuco and walking distance to a couple good restaurants, one of them Italian. Just one piece of advice: request a downstairs room in the summertime as the 2nd floor does not cool off well summer months; the upstairs rooms get quite hot and do not cool off well at night. Otherwise, it is good value for the cost.

Stayed in May 2014 and the place had just been remodeled: all beds and most furniture were brand new, which was excellent! The owner is very friendly and helpful: we stayed as a family, and she was always aware and attentive to our kids. The breakfast was very nice. There is a small kitchen that you can use to heat your food if you are having lunch or dinner there, which is where breakfast is served. The place is very conveniently located about 2 blocks from the Portal Temuco mall, which is a common stop for shopping in Temuco.

We stayed one night as a stopover on route to Puerto Montt. The room was excellent. The Hotel is very friendly to families travelling with kids (we werent the only ones with kids). Near by you have many restaurants, the city mall and city Casino are walking distance. We didnt went to the casino, but if you like to, the staff will babysit your kids - along with the kids of other guests - while you play. The breakfast wasnt the 'huge' traditional southern breakfast, but was fine. Checkout was very quick and hastle free.

Such a lovely alternative to a hotel! We booked from Canada and they sent a taxi to the airport to meet us. Our room was spotlessly clean with a large, very comfortable bed, with crisp, white linens. Walking distance to a nice cafe where we had dinner. We slept with the window open and heard nothing at night (quiet, residential street). The next morning we walked to the regional museum. We intended to go into the center to catch a bus to Valdivia, but the owner called the same taxi driver who took us to a small, local bus depot. On route, the driver also took us to a viewpoint where we could see the whole city & area. Before the bus left, the driver returned with my husband's camera, that he had left in the taxi. This is a very welcoming family run guest house with excellent service.

I stayed 3 nights during a work trip and felt like a part of the family from the minute I arrived. Owners and staff are all friendly and personable. The hostal has a "homie" atmosphere and the room was very comfortable with en-suite bathroom, warm cozy bed and a flatscreen tv. Breakfast is included which consists of bread, selection of jams / spreads, meat, cheese, yogurt, fruit, cereal, muffins, coffee, tea and juice. The location was also close to the mall, restaurants and convenience stores...this was nice since I did not have a car. I recommend to anyone visiting Temuco!
